我在FieldEditorPreferencePage中遇到布局设置问题.
我的代码是这样的:
public void createFieldEditors () {
Group pv = new group(getfieldEditorParent(), SWT.SHADOW_OUT);
Group of = new group(getfieldEditorParent(), SWT.SHADOW_OUT);
pv.setText(“pv”);
of.setText(“of”);
GridLayout layout = new GridLayout(2,false);
pv.setLayout(layout);
of.setLayout(layout);
addField(new StringFieldEditor(“PreferenceStore name”,“Text:”, pv);
addField(new StringFieldEditor(“PreferenceStore name”,“Text:”, pv);
addField(new StringFieldEditor(“PreferenceStore name”,“Text:”, of);
addField(new StringFieldEditor(“PreferenceStore name”,“Text:”, of);
and so on.
}
Run Code Online (Sandbox Code Playgroud)
问题是它不适用于GridLayout.
StringFieldEditors不是并行的.列数始终为1.此外,当我尝试更改组中StringFieldEditors的大小时,它也不起作用.
有人有什么想法吗?
谢谢.
有人知道以编程方式检测停放的网页吗?也就是说,那些你不小心输入的页面(或有时是有意的),它们由域名停放服务托管,只有广告.
我正在建立一个链接网络,并希望确保过期的网站不会被其他人抢走,然后成为停放的网页.
在渲染HTML SELECT时,IE似乎忽略了CSS中设置的高度.有没有为此工作或我们必须接受IE看起来不如其他浏览器?
简单的问题.我正在考虑Firebird和SQLite即将推出的项目.SQLite有SQLite管理员,这是非常好的但得到+ 1M,因为它有自动完成.但是Firebird支持FK,所以我对它更加满意.我现在正倾向于Firebird.
你最喜欢的Firebird IDE是什么?为什么?
编辑:就个人而言,我会倾向于免费的,因为我在这个项目上没有做太多.但我会按原样保留这个问题.
我无可救药地试图编写一个方法来操作ruby中的数组.我正在尝试生成一个数组的所有有序排列,其中每个项目又被外部项目替换.一个例子...
给定输入:
arr = ["a", "b", "c"]
Run Code Online (Sandbox Code Playgroud)
期望的输出:
newArr = [ ["a", "b", "c"], ["a", "b", "*"], ["a", "*", "c"], ["a", "*", "*"], ["*", "b", "c"], ["*", "b", "*"], ["*", "*", "c"], ["*", "*", "*"] ]
Run Code Online (Sandbox Code Playgroud)
任何帮助将不胜感激.谢谢!
有人可以尽可能详细地解释以下类型之间的差异吗?
List
List<Object>
List<?>
Run Code Online (Sandbox Code Playgroud)
让我更具体一点.我什么时候想用
// 1
public void CanYouGiveMeAnAnswer(List l) { }
// 2
public void CanYouGiveMeAnAnswer(List<Object> l) { }
// 3
public void CanYouGiveMeAnAnswer(List<?> l) { }
Run Code Online (Sandbox Code Playgroud) 我目前是一名研究生,但在回到学校之前,我已经在这个行业工作了几年.
我参加了一个班级,其中有4个团队正在开展相当雄心勃勃的项目.由于已经进入这个行业,我有很多"软件工程"经验,我的队友们缺乏(他们本学期第一次使用SVN).他们都是非常优秀的程序员; 但是他们在构建"真实的东西"方面没有很多经验.
由于我对一个项目有一个相当具体的愿景,而我的队友没有,我的想法是我们将在本学期开展的工作.最重要的是,由于我的经验,加上我承认自己具有一定的个性,我已成为事实上的团队领导 - 建立每周会议时间,分配初始任务等.
我想避免陷入对我们应该做什么以及我们应该如何做的强烈思想的陷阱,我的队友们觉得他们没有发言权并且没有参与其中.
所以这是一个问题:
如何在执行基本最佳实践(版本控制,里程碑等)和一致的项目愿景的同时,保持我的团队中没有纪律但又有才华的程序员的积极性?
编辑:感谢所有回答到目前为止的人.我想我过分强调了事物的"软件工程"方面; 我也在寻找如何鼓励我的队友为设计做出贡献的想法,并感受到项目的所有权,而目前这一点是" The SquareCog(和朋友)秀!"
有时我在尝试移动,重命名或以其他方式操作计算机上的某些文件或文件夹时会收到此错误消息...
目标文件夹访问被拒绝您需要获得执行此操作的权限http://img222.imageshack.us/img222/1581/destinationfolderaccessms9.jpg
我需要做些什么才能获得控制权?
我正在尝试为一个模块编写一个单元测试,它会根据某些标准给出一个随机的数字列表.
我正在写的特定测试是对原始序列的重新洗牌.我正在测试那个
这样做的问题是,有时序列是在相同的顺序.处理这个问题的最佳方法是什么?
我正在使用NUnit(但如果它有帮助,可以使用另一个测试框架).
说我有以下内容:
tr {
background: #fff;
}
tr.even {
background: #eee
}
tr.highlight {
background: #fec;
}
Run Code Online (Sandbox Code Playgroud)
是否可以指定第4个背景(#fea
)而不是highlight
简单地覆盖even
?
<tr class="even highlight">
<!-- ... -->
</tr>
Run Code Online (Sandbox Code Playgroud)
一旦支持CSS3,:nth-child
可能会有效.但是,在此期间有什么可用的吗?
tr { /* ... */ }
tr:nth-child(even) { /* ... */ }
tr.highlight { /* ... */ }
tr.highlight:nth-child(even) { /* ... */ }
Run Code Online (Sandbox Code Playgroud)